Ghost hunters are on the trail of a supernatural phenomenon and legendary figures in Scotland. The forest of Duffus Castle - long one of Scotland's most powerful fortresses - is as much the scene of eerie encounters as Kilneuair Cemetery or Duart Castle on the Isle of Mull.
